    In a city, the ratio of the number of men to number of women is 3:2. If number of men increases by 10% & number of women decreases by 500 then final population of city increases by 5%. Find initial number of men in city.
    Solutions
    Given number of men increases by 10% and Let number of women decreases by x%

    Ratio of number of men to number of women = 3:2 = 15:10

    5% - x% = 7.5%

    =>

    Negative sign shows that number of women is decreasing.

    According to question

    2.5% = 500

    1% = 200

    100% = 20000

    Hence total number of women = 20000

    Now, ratio of number of men to number of women is 3:2

    2 unit = 20000

    1 unit = 10000

    3 unit = 30000

    Hence initial number of men in city = 30000
